📈 Results

To train a model, run:

CUDA_VISIBLE_DEVICES=<your_desired_GPU> \
python train_s2s_2d.py \
     <your_data_path> \
    --model vm2  \
    --batch_size 2  \
    --lambda 0.1 \
    --data_loss mse \
    --epochs 1500 \
    --steps_per_epoch 100 \
    --model_dir <your_dir_to_save_model> 

Acknowledgement

Our code is based on the implementation of VoxelMorph.
